This is a set of 16 digital scrap booking papers. It includes 8 polka dot prints and 8 stripe prints plus 2 BONUS papers. All papers are PNG files. Can be used for personal or commercial use, no license necessary.

You need to extract the files. If your computer does not have the option to unzip files (extract) them, you need to download a program that can unzip files for you. There are many free ones on the internet. If you need additional help you can email me at theenlightenedelephant@gmail.com

To insert a .png file (which is what the digital papers are), you have to have a word processing or ppt file already open, then select insert image, find the file (image) you want to insert and then click open (or OK, or insert).
